Output 2b589eb37f9e17ecf63f36dee61f883ed53282a83c38f04f6dfe3337f13228a8:0

value
90838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51afa43490e15ea1b65477652c4306421771710e OP_EQUAL
address
398w4ry6Qi4JUpcc5pGNAC5vntzQF4fhUX
transaction
2b589eb37f9e17ecf63f36dee61f883ed53282a83c38f04f6dfe3337f13228a8
spent
true